Yachts Asia-Pacific magazine closes
By IBI Magazine
The Yachts Group has announced that it is to close one of its magazines, Yachts Asia-Pacific. According to Bruce Maxwell, president and managing editor, Yachts Asia-Pacific, for the last two years the magazine had been published on a far higher print run, and with a much more targeted circulation, than had ever been attempted in the region. "Unfortunately, doing this properly also requires higher ad rates than the region has been used to, and incurs heavy Asia-Pacific distribution costs," Maxwell said. "In recent circumstances, it is difficult to continue this course economically, and Yachts Group CEO Michel Karsenti does not want to lower our levels, or see his excellent European and North American publications compromised, to deal with problems arising in this often volatile market." Maxwell will remain as a feature writer with the Yachts Group, and as in the past, will handle some Asia-Pacific advertising and promotions.
(19 April 2004)
